Twists and Turns is a tale on the scale of Greek myth, about the inescapable entanglements of family relationships, that can lead one, in hyperbolic mode, to envision murder and suicide, for, as Cixous writes, "with love's force one hates. " And yet, "everything twists and turns": this is a tale with profoundly touching reversals.
